Description

  • Lev Samoilovich Bakst
  • Costume design for the Page of the Cherry Fairy from a production of The Sleeping Beauty
  • signed in Latin and dated 1921 l.r.
  • watercolour over pencil heightened with gold and silver
  • 28 by 21.5cm., 11 by 8 1/2 in.

Provenance

Rasamatt, Paris

Condition

The sheet appears sound but slightly discoloured. The colours have faded a bit. There are minor spots of staining and foxing in places. Held in a simple silverpainted wood frame and behind glass; unexamined out of glass.
